Abstract: Cross-border mergers and acquisitions (M&As) have become a cornerstone of corporate strategy for firms seeking to enhance their competitive advantage, expand market reach, and acquire critical technological capabilities in an increasingly interconnected global economy. In the contemporary digital era, these transactions play a pivotal role in fostering innovation, particularly within technology-intensive industries where the pace of change is relentless.
